The Shift Towards Steel Frame Buildings
Historically, brick and mortar have been the backbone of the UK’s construction industry. However, as the demands for faster, more cost-effective, and sustainable construction methods increase, steel frame buildings have emerged as a viable alternative. This shift can be attributed to several factors:
Durability and Strength: Steel is inherently strong and can withstand extreme weather conditions, making it an ideal choice for the UK’s often unpredictable climate. Unlike traditional materials such as wood, steel does not warp, rot, or expand, ensuring the longevity of the structure.
Speed of Construction: Time is a critical factor in the construction industry. Steel frame buildings offer a significant advantage in terms of speed. The components of a steel frame structure are pre-fabricated off-site and assembled on-site, reducing construction time considerably. This process not only speeds up the project timeline but also minimizes disruption to the surrounding area.

The versatility of steel enables the construction of large, open spaces without the need for internal load-bearing walls, providing more usable space within the building.
Cost-Effectiveness: While the initial cost of steel may be higher than other materials, the overall cost-effectiveness of steel frame buildings becomes evident over time. The reduced construction time, lower maintenance costs, and long-term durability of steel structures contribute to significant savings in the long run.
Environmental Benefits: Sustainability is a growing concern in the construction industry. Steel is 100% recyclable, making it an environmentally friendly choice. Additionally, steel frame buildings are energy-efficient, as they can be easily insulated to meet high standards of thermal performance. This not only reduces energy consumption but also lowers the carbon footprint of the building.
Applications of Steel Frame Buildings
The versatility of steel frame buildings makes them suitable for a wide range of applications across various sectors. Some of the key areas where steel frame construction is gaining traction include:
Commercial Buildings: Steel frame buildings are increasingly being used in the construction of commercial spaces such as offices, retail centers, and warehouses. The ability to create large, open-plan spaces without internal columns makes steel an ideal choice for commercial buildings that require flexible layouts.
Residential Buildings: While traditionally less common in residential construction, steel frame homes are becoming more popular in the UK. The strength and durability of steel, combined with its design flexibility, allow for the creation of modern, stylish homes that are built to last.
Industrial Buildings: Steel has long been the material of choice for industrial buildings such as factories, manufacturing plants, and storage facilities. The robustness of steel can support heavy machinery and equipment, while the speed of construction helps meet the tight timelines often required in industrial projects.
Agricultural Buildings: The agricultural sector has also embraced steel frame construction for buildings such as barns, stables, and storage facilities. Steel’s resistance to pests and weather damage makes it a practical and cost-effective choice for rural applications.
Public and Institutional Buildings: Schools, hospitals, and other public buildings are increasingly being constructed using steel frames due to their durability and the ability to create large, adaptable spaces. The quick construction process also ensures that these essential facilities can be built and operational in a shorter timeframe.
